Exploring THCA: A Journey into THC's Root
THCA, or tetrahydrocannabinolic acid, serves as the non-psychoactive precursor to THC. Present in raw cannabis plants, it converts to its psychoactive counterpart when exposed to heat. This transformation is often initiated by the act of smoking or vaping cannabis, resulting in the well-known effects associated with THC. While THCA itself does not produce a "high", it possesses several potential therapeutic benefits that are currently being studied. These include analgesic properties, neuroprotective effects, and the potential to ease symptoms of certain diseases.
